- 如果本地没有生成过公钥、私钥,可用如下命令生成
ssh-keygen -
cd ~/.ssh可看到image.png
3.复制id_rsa.pub中内容到开发机的~/.ssh目录下的authorized_keys中
4.最重要的一步(本人就是踩了这个坑导致一直不能免密登录成功!!)修改文件开发机文件夹、文件的权限
chmod 700 /home/jack
chmod 700 ~/.ssh
chmod 600 ~/.ssh/authorized_keys - 一直好奇known_hosts文件夹是做什么的?
----------存放客户端主机的公钥列表
ssh免密登录小坑
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
